Librarian's report: ort: Tammy Benninger has been hired as the new Youth Services Librarian and started city employment on November 11,2013. Ms. Benninger moved from Pitkin County, CO to take this position and has already become immersed in daily library operations. With the new fiscal year underway,two more Early Literacy Stations have been ordered and delivered for use in the Youth Department. This brings the total number of learning centers to four,with the newest additions replacing eight-year-old machines. The library has once again been selected as a World Book Night site for 2014. The book giveaway is scheduled for April 23,2014, and the library will again host a gathering prior to that date in order to allow book givers to pick up their titles and to meet one another before dispersing books to the community. The library will not be mounting a Food for Fines campaign this year,but will instead focus on seeking donations for the Wichita County Humane Society and the P.E.T.S. low cost spay&neuter clinic. More creative staff members already have ideas on how to decorate the Christmas tree in a pet-friendly manner, and youth crafts are being planned that center around four-legged friends. Two RFID conversion stations have been leased for a month from 3M in order to begin the process of tagging all barcoded library material. To date,over 40,000 tags have already been applied,with staff averaging between 6,500-6,700 items per day. There is a degree of time sensitivity to the process since the monthly rental cost of each machine is$3,000. 3M,however,is well aware that there are holidays and closings coming up shortly,and have been extremely generous in that they are allowing us plenty of wiggle room! Hopefully this project will be completed by mid-December,with new security gates and new Self Checks installed and operational by the end of the year. Friends' report: The next book sale will be December 5-7. The Friends have also received a donated minivan that they plan to put to good use. The organization remains committed to helping the library maintain a monthly standing order for Playaway Views,and is looking ahead to 2014,planning their annual Dr. Seuss celebration during the first weekend in March.
